This was to be a quiet day before starting our Rocky Mountaineer adventure. After a leisurely breakfast we went back to our hotel gathered our luggage and wheeled it a few blocks to the Calgary Fairmount Hotel where we were to stay that night. Part of our tour included entry to the Calgary Skytower which was located basically next door to the Fairmount. Here we were able to take in some magical views from 525 feet above the city. I really thought Calgary was a very modern city with beautiful gardens and hanging baskets every where. The afternoon each of us did our own thing. After a Nana nap I found my way to an area where three blocks of the street had been blocked off for pedestrians only. Just wandered amongst the cafes and bars and did a lot of 'people watching'. A couple of drinks with Jenny and Pete and a reasonably early night.
